1. Product Description
The JT-ZL2010 household standalone combustible gas detector (detector) adopts high quality gas sensor; It is made with high performance MCU and advanced electronic elements as well as sophisticated technologies; Its software and hardware technologies enable it to monitor sensor failure simultaneously when detecting gas leak concentration, which, at the same time, brings high degree of safety and reliability. This detector is suitable for installing in residential houses with potential gas leakage, it can consecutively monitor indoor combustible gas concentration, when the gas cocentration reaches its alarming value, it will send out soundand light alarm and could automatically close the solenoid valve to shut off the gas supply, it could also start the exhaust fan to remove the gas out from the room. It will helpyou to take immediate action to prevent fire, blast and injury accidents from happening. Standard implemented: EN 50194-1:2009

4. Installation Instruction 4.1 This detector is suitable for indoor environment only, please install it at places with potential gas leakage or gathering, and it should be installed horizontally 1m~4m from the gas appliance and vertically >0.3m from the ceiling. Users could choose install the detector according to below diagram based on actual situation.
- 4 -

4.2 Avoid areas as below Areas of ventilation inlet/outlet, exhaust fan, doors/windows with strong air flow. Areas with moisture and water drops. Areas right above heat source or water steam. Areas above gas appliances. Areas easy to be polluted. Areas covered by obstacles.
If the room is to be painted or refurbished, please install the detector after the refurbishment or painting work.
4.3 Installation Method
1) Choose a place on the wall suitable for installing the detector. 2) Slide the mounting plate down. 3) Use expansion screws to fix the installation baseplate. 4) Power on the detector and check to ensure it works normally; If external devices such as solenoid valve, please connect the wires correctly. 5) Install the detector by hanging it onto the baseplate.

5. Operating Instruction
1) Connect the detector to the power source, green power source indicator will flash, then the detector will enter preheat status and lasts for 3 minutes, during preheating, the detector could not detect gas leakage; 3 minutes later, the detector will enter normal detection mode, its green power source indicator will be normally on. 2) When the gas concentration value in the air reaches the set alarming point, the detector will enter alarming mode, its red indicator will flash, at the same time, it sends out beeping alarm; Then, please shut off the gas supply immediately and open the window, and do not turn on any electrical appliances (including cellphone), if necessary, please ask for gas experts to eliminate the gas leakage failure. 3) In the alarm state, when the gas concentration value is below the safe value, the detector will disarm the alarm automatically, if the detector sends out sound-light alarm, it means the gas concentration exceed standard. 4) If the ring light show yellow, on all the time, and beep all the time, it means detector faults, cannot detect correctly, please contact distributor for repairing. 5) For daily check, please short-press the button once, the detector will enter simulate alarming mode and it will send out sound-light alarm signal, red indicator light flash and beep, return the normal detect state later, if the detector does not alarm normally, please contact distributor or manufacturer for repairing. 6) If the service life indicator is on, that means the sensor life is due,
- 6 -

please contact the distributor or manufacturer for repair or buying a new one. 7) Indicator light status

7. Notes
1) The large number of cigarette smoke, alcohol or volatile organic compounds like petrol, perfume, banana oil or paints inside the room may cause the detector to alarm; 2) Do not use gas sample without clear concentration value to test this detector,ultra-high concentration gas will not only damage shorten the detector sensor service life but also harm human health; 3) Please contact your distributor or manufacturer for help and use correct gas sample with correct concentration value to test the detector once a year;
- 8 -

4) This product cannot be used nor stored in any environment with corrosive gases (like chlorine gas); 5) Please routinely clean the dust or oil contamination on the detector surface with brush or dry soft rag; 6) After long-term storage or long-time transportation, please power the detector on and wait for 24 hours or more to realize optimal performance. 7) Under normal operating environment, the semiconductor sensor could work for 5 years.
8. Product Maintenance 1) Please clean the detector at least one time a year, make sure its gas inlet is free of dust or oil contamination; 2) After cleaning, install the detector back to its baseplate and conduct function check; 3) Conduct an analog alarming test each half year to make sure it works normally; 4) Do not expose the detector to high concentration gas sample for long time or frequently, or it will lower its sensor sensitivity or shorten its sensor life or even damage the sensor; 5) The detector should be connected to stable power source; 6) When detector is found in failure status, please contact the distributor or manufacturer for repair or buy a new one.
